can a triangle could have side lengths of 4 cm, 3 cm, and 10 cm?

Respuesta :

Jason2018Tang Jason2018Tang
  • 23-03-2021

Answer: No

Step-by-step explanation:

No since two sides of a triangle must be greater than the third. But in this scenario, 4+3<10 meaning those side lengths cannot make a triangle.
